JOB DESCRIPTION

1. Lead the definition and development of the innovative antenna system and coordinate vehicle integration

2. Develop the tests methodology, lead the simulation, prototyping, calibration, validation and road tests

3. Deliver outstanding requirements, system definition, interfaces, implementation, testing and debugging strategy

4. Manage the suppliers technical relationship to deliver innovative technical solutions within required cost, quality and time targets

5. Manage the relationship with hardware/software/mechanical teams dealing with antennas and coordinate specifications

6. Stay on top of technology innovation in the antenna field and design future 5G MIMO solutions

DESIRED SKILLS AND EXPERIENCE

  • Masters in Computer Science or equivalent
  • At least 4 years of experience on automotive antennas projects
  • Good knowledge of antenna design principles
  • Good knowledge of automotive radio frequencies challenges
  • Experience in antenna hardware design for cellular, Wifi, GNSS
  • Experience with antenna measurement protocols and tools
  • Experience of 3D simulation tools
  • Skills on antenna simulation, testing, debugging and optimization
  • Experience in telematics systems development
  • Strong ability to drive results from empirical data
  • Project management skills
  • Strong motivation for technology oriented products
  • Ability to work in a multi-cultural and inter-disciplinary team across different time zones
  • Ability to work outdoors

APPRECIATED OTHERS SKILLS

  • Other languages (Chinese, German, French…)
  • Experience in AGILE, SCRUM
  • Experience in NB IoT, V2X
  • Knowledge of FCC/IEC/ICNIRP CAR/HAC regulations
